Hiking in COVID Times: Traveling to San Dimas to Avoid the Crowds


With county trails open and people getting antsy and leaving their homes, some of the more popular spots are jam-packed: Witness what happened last weekend at Eaton Canyon, a popular spot that was shut down on Memorial Day due to the crush of people flooding the park to hike to its famed waterfall.




We drove a bit further to San Dimas, where the Michael D. Antonovich Trail offered a bit of a less-crowded hiking experience -- mostly shady, thanks to a creek that runs along the path way. Socially distant hiking isn't easy, and we kept our masks on -- as did many of the other hikers we came across.
